ANSS was delisted on the 16th of July, 2025.

870 hedge funds and large institutions have $28.8B invested in Ansys in 2024 Q4 according to their latest regulatory filings, with 110 funds opening new positions, 305 increasing their positions, 309 reducing their positions, and 65 closing their positions.
